On Wednesday 16 April 2003 19:06, Neil Munro wrote:
> I've just installed 3.1 and cannot see how to set Desktop mouse actions,
> it used to be (taken from the online help):
>
> "Open the KDE Control Center and choose LookNFeel->Desktop. You can now
> choose the behavior of mouse clicks on the desktop. To have the K menu
> open from a single left mouse button click, change the entry labeled
> Left button to say Application Menu."

That has changed indeed, it's now "KDE Control Center, choose Desktop -> 
Behavior." Lauri, can you update the help accordingly?
